The Orvane Labs bike cage and the east and west parking gates operate on separate access schedules, and facilities desk staff should note that visitor vehicles may only use the west gate between 07:00 and 19:00. Cyclists requesting cage access must show a valid day pass, and their details should be entered in the access ledger before the cage is opened. Gates must never be propped open, even briefly, during deliveries. When a manual override is required at either gate, use the code below.

staff pass of fadup-fawig = bdg-FUNKS-4

The renewal of our three-year agreement with Torvane Materials has been assessed in detail. Proposed terms include a 4.2% unit-price increase, partially offset by improved volume rebates and extended payment terms of sixty days. Sensitivity analysis indicates a net annual cost impact of under 1% on the Meridia product line, assuming stable demand. Legal has flagged no material changes to liability clauses. We recommend approval, subject to the conditions outlined in the confidential note below.

confidential, yawip-bahif: Zorokox Partners plans to lower the Casax list price by 28.0 percent in April. The board signed off on a budget of $271.0 million for Project Juldor. The renewal with Pelokox Partners closes at $410.1 million a year, 3.4 percent below the last contract. Project Pelok slips by a full year because of the audit delay.

## Changelog 2.8.0 — Defaults changed

Bricklane's incremental rebuild now hashes dependency graphs instead of timestamps. Plugins emitting dynamic routes must declare them explicitly or they will be skipped. Full rebuild fallback triggers less aggressively. Cache eviction defaults tightened. Update your plugin manifests accordingly. The new default configuration shipped with this release follows.

settings of tagef-bawif:
DRUIX_HOST=druix.zemvarlabs.internal
DRUIX_PORT=8000

- [ ] Step 7: Archive cold storage buckets (Glacierline tier). Confirm both ceremony witnesses are present, verify bucket manifests match the Oxbow ledger, then seal the archive key shares. Plugin authors may observe but not handle shares. Once sealed, the archive index itself is encrypted and can only be reopened with the passphrase below.

vault phrase of badup-hahig = tamael-aldael-kelmir-istael-fenok-istwyn-tamius-jorath-oliion